SAS interface and connectivity
SAS, or Serial Attached SCSI (Small Computer System Interface), is a type of interface and data transfer protocol used for connecting hard disk drives and other storage devices to a host computer or server. It is designed to provide faster data transfer rates and greater scalability than traditional parallel SCSI interfaces.
SAS uses a serial architecture, which means that data is transferred one bit at a time, as opposed to the parallel architecture used in parallel SCSI. This allows for higher data transfer rates, as well as the ability to connect more devices to a single SAS host bus adapter.
SAS uses a point-to-point connection, which means that each device is connected directly to the host, rather than being connected to a shared bus. This improves reliability and scalability, as well as allowing for greater distance between the host and devices.
SAS devices can be daisy-chained together, allowing for multiple devices to be connected to a single SAS host bus adapter. This allows for increased scalability and greater storage capacity.

Data Management and Security
Data management and security refer to the methods and technologies used to protect and organize data stored on the Dell 400-AVBE Hard Disk Drive.
One way data can be managed and secured is through the use of RAID (Redundant Array of Independent Disks) technology. RAID allows for the creation of multiple virtual disks from multiple physical disks, providing data redundancy and improved performance. This can be done by using software-based RAID or hardware-based RAID. Hardware-based RAID is built into the disk controller, and it provides faster performance and lower CPU utilization than software-based RAID.
Another way to secure data is by using SED (Self-Encrypting Drive) technology. SED uses hardware-based encryption to protect data stored on the drive. The encryption is done on the drive itself, and it is transparent to the host system. This means that the host does not need to have any special software to encrypt or decrypt the data. This helps to protect data stored on the drive in case of theft or loss, as the data cannot be accessed without the encryption key.
Hot-swap capability
Hot-swap capability allows for the removal and replacement of a hard disk drive while the system is still running, without the need to power down the system or disrupt normal operations. This feature is useful for maintenance and upgrades, as well as for adding or replacing failed drives in a RAID configuration.
